Python eval 함수 원리 및 용법 해석

943 단어 Pythoneval함수.
eval 함 수 는 list,dict,tuple 과 str 간 의 전환 을 실현 하 는 것 입 니 다.
str 함수 가 list,dict,tuple 을 문자열 로 변환 합 니 다.
1.문자열 을 목록 으로 변환

a = "[[1,2], [3,4], [5,6], [7,8], [9,0]]"
print(type(a))
b = eval(a)print(type(b))
print(b)

2.문자열 을 사전 으로 변환

a = "{1: 'a', 2: 'b'}"
print(type(a))
b = eval(a)
print(type(b))
print(b)

3.문자열 을 원 그룹 으로 변환 합 니 다.

a = "([1,2], [3,4], [5,6], [7,8], (9,0))"
print(type(a))
b=eval(a)
print(type(b))
print(b)

이상 이 바로 본 고의 모든 내용 입 니 다.여러분 의 학습 에 도움 이 되 고 저 희 를 많이 응원 해 주 셨 으 면 좋 겠 습 니 다.

좋은 웹페이지 즐겨찾기